Hi guys, Im new to the forum and I recently bought a 73' Mustang hard top with a 302 and C4 transmission. I've recently replaced the fuel pump, water pump, and starter solenoid. The guy I got it from had it torn apart but I figured I could work on it. So here is my issue--well, two issues. 1. When I turn the key, the starter fires up and the engine cranks and runs, however, the starter will not shut off. When I back the key off a little bit the whole engine shuts off all together. I was able to disconnect the starter from the starter solenoid and with the key in the "on" position I can crank the engine by touching the starter wire to the starter solenoid and when it cranks I disconnect it.. I was able to have the engine idle for an extended period of time while I tuned the carb. This brings me to my next problem. If I am not pushing on the shifter all the way into park the whole car just shuts off like a kill switch.
I purchased a new starter switch and am going to troubleshoot the wires tomorrow, and from what I have researched.. the transmission problem could be linked to the neutral safety switch? Am I going in the right direction? any other pointers? also, the ignition switch seems like a pain to get to. Any info would be greatly appreciated. Thank you.
